Album Notes

Jerome Anthony Rhyant was born in Fort Pierce, Florida to two very loving parents, Odessa and Pastor Thomas Rhyant, Sr. Jerome followed his father’s strict philosophy for his sons, there were three unconditional house rules... you had to sing, work, and go to church. Singers with high falsetto voices such as his older brother Thomas Jr., legendary soul singer Peabo Bryson and Phillip Bailey of the universal hit act "Earth, Wind, & Fire", always inspired Jerome. At the tender age of five along with his three talented brothers, Jerome started performing at various venues in different parts of the country; they called themselves, "The Rhyant Singers".

Little did Jerome Rhyant know that one day all of his tireless efforts would lead him to one of the biggest record producers in the history of the music business, Maurice Starr. After listening to some of Jerome’s music, Maurice could not believe Rhyant’s incredible vocal ability and immediately agreed to take on the future star.

Maurice Starr is known for discovering, producing and managing pop teen icons, “New Kids On The Block” and R&B hit teen sensation, “New Addition”. Starr’s music has sold over 500 Million Records, generated more than 6 billion dollars in revenue, and earned him hundreds of gold and platinum records from around the world.

Starr believes that Rhyant's new song, “The Ten Commandments”, written and arranged by Jerome Rhyant and friend, Frederick Esters, Jr., with its mid-tempo beat will bond people from all walks of life, uniting them for a common cause… that we can change the world, one person at a time. The single, “I Cherish Your Love”, written by Maurice Starr, is a song that expresses the Love one has for another, a love that is precious, and a love that is cherished. Producer Carlo Tennisi and songwriter Wanda Xula have also contributed their expertise and talent to this wonderful song.
